Changing Perceptions at the Health & Safety Event 2025

When CLEAN Linen Services Ltd decided to exhibit at the Health & Safety Event 2025 at the NEC, the team knew they needed more than just a stand—they needed to tell a story. As a UK-based laundry company specialising in linen and workwear rental, CLEAN has long served the hospitality and manufacturing sectors, offering everything from bed linen and towels to flame-retardant PPE. But there was a common misconception in the market—that they were simply a supplier of uniforms. For Ted Walker, Head of Group Marketing at CLEAN, this event was an opportunity to change that narrative.

A Stand with a Purpose

The Health & Safety Event brought together exactly the kind of professionals CLEAN wanted to reach—health and safety managers and decision-makers from sectors where compliance and cleanliness matter. But reaching them meant doing more than turning up. CLEAN wanted a stand that would attract attention, open conversations, and tell the full story of what they offer.

They turned to Park Display, a partner they had trusted for several years. But this time, the brief came with a creative twist: “Let’s do something different.”

Showing, Not Just Telling

CLEAN wanted visitors to understand they weren’t just handing out uniforms—they were offering a complete, managed service. The big idea? A large screen playing a washing machine in action. It wasn’t a gimmick—it was the visual hook that made people stop and ask questions.

“We wanted to communicate that we’re not just a PPE supplier,” said Ted. “That washing machine video made it really clear what we’re about.”

The stand also showcased CLEAN’s workwear in a more imaginative way than ever before. Instead of the usual mannequins on the floor, Park Display suspended the garments, allowing them to hang naturally in the air, almost like they were caught mid-motion. Alongside this, a comfortable seating area invited visitors to stay and talk, while built-in storage kept the stand tidy and efficient.
